Wilbur Strake was a minor character featured in the 1960s Gothic soap opera Dark Shadows. He was played by actor Joseph Julian and appeared in episode 1 as well as episode 2.

Biography

Wilbur Strake was a private investigator hired by Burke Devlin to investigate the Collins family. To conduct his work surreptitiously, Strake began posing as a real estate agent. In 1966, Burke met up with Strake at the Blue Whale to find out what the P.I. had discovered. He provided him with an update on Elizabeth Collins Stoddard, informing him of how she still ran the family fishing fleet, but has remained a recluse at the family's estate of Collinwood, having never left the property in over eighteen years. Strake had several theories as to why this was, but admitted that none of them made a lot of sense. (DS: 1) In another meeting, Strake gave Devlin all of the information he had gained about Elizabeth's daughter, Carolyn. (DS: 2)

Burke then had Strake look into Elizabeth's new hired hand, Victoria Winters. Aware that Victoria recently came to Collinsport from New York, he sent Strake to the Hammond Family Home where Vicki was raised. Under the guise of a magazine writer, Strake probed the foundling home's administrator Mrs. Hopewell, asking about Victoria's past and how Elizabeth's brother, Roger Collins, came to learn of her. Soon after, Burke ceased his investigation of the Collins family and Strake was let go. (DS: 8)

The Collins Family eventually found out about Strake and Burke lied to them, insisting that he had hired him to investigate the financial opportunities in town. (DS: 21)
